Abandoned people stay in abandoned buildings and they don't usually clean up after themselves.
One of my first successful efforts at an HDR, using the freeware version of Photomatix.
I like the way the wall in this came out looking. It's actually a corner, so that gives the deteriorated pattern a distinctive look. I had a hard time deciding how to adjust it, as minor tweaks made large differences in the appearance. I tried adjusting the tones for a little more oomph in the wall, but felt it then overpowered the rest of the image, so I backed it off a bit. It's still not subtle, though I do expect to get some comments suggesting how I could have done the wall differently.
There is no roof on this building either, but lots of trees overhead, so I had strong but diffused lighting. I may take some detail shots of this wall next time to use as overlays.
